Statutory reporting can actually help internal oversight by encouraging regular data reporting, transparency and compliance. This also helps align finance, operations, HR and compliance teams under consistent data sets as well as supply forecasting tools with valuable information. Then there are the matters of mistakes, whether that is a misapplication of a formula, misinterpretation of a rule or simply a missed deadline. With its audit process, statutory reporting finds and fixes these sorts of errors in an annual report or other statement. Advanced tools such as data checks driven by artificial intelligence can improve this by catching errors faster than a manual review process. These platforms also can store and track changes in real time to ensure there are no duplicated efforts or lost data.

The work of statutory reporting teams is highly detail-oriented and involves gathering data from various entities. One of the challenges they face is ensuring consistency across annual statements, audited financials, and MD&A. Another challenge is managing redundant information presented in different, disconnected documents that must be updated individually across multiple entities.
